About the Hotel
Holiday Inn Express London Greenwich is located in Greenwich, known for its rich maritime history and UNESCO World Heritage Sites. The hotel offers contemporary accommodations with modern amenities. It is within a short distance from major attractions such as the Cutty Sark and the National Maritime Museum. The convenient transport links make it ideal for exploring the broader London area.
Location
Located in southeast London, the hotel is a short distance from key Greenwich attractions like the Royal Observatory. North Greenwich Underground Station is just a 15-minute walk away, connecting guests to central London. There is also on-site parking available at a charge and easy access to various public transport options, including buses and river cruises.
Rooms
The hotel features bright and airy bedrooms with complimentary WiFi and a 32-inch flat-screen TV. Each room also includes an en suite shower room and a work desk for business-related tasks. Guests can choose between soft or firm pillows for a personalized sleep experience. Additionally, family rooms are available, which come equipped with a handy sofa bed for children.
Eat & Drink
Guests can start their day with the inclusive Express Start Breakfast, which includes both hot and continental options. The hotel's stylish bar offers a selection of wines, craft beers, and cocktails for evening relaxation. Throughout the day, guests can order from a varied menu that includes curry, burgers, and pizzas, available in the lounge.
Leisure & Business
The hotel provides on-site meeting facilities with natural light, accommodating up to 75 people. Free Wi-Fi is available throughout the property, and business services like printing and copying can be arranged. For recreational activities, guests may enjoy the nearby O2 Arena, which hosts a range of concerts and entertainment events.
